Dear Listers,
The possible itinerary for next years trip has changed. Have a look at the
possibilities below:
- Fly into Brussels.
- Visit Leiden (where the Pilgrims lived before heading back to England and
hiring the Mayflower for their transatlantic journey [Rebecca has some
wonderful research to share with the group there as well]) and Antwerp (where Sir
Richard Clough spent a great deal of time in the service of Sir Thomas Gresham -
financial advisor to Queen Elizabeth I).
- Head to Paris.
- Visit Versailles.
- Visit Castle Blain (see 'Descendants of John Clough of Salisbury, Mass.'
vol. I).
- Take a ferry across the English Channel. Head to Salisbury to visit
Salisbury Cathedral and Stonehenge.
- Head to London. Take John Clough walk-about with Rebecca. Perhaps meet
with a few Clough family members there.
- Head to York. Possibly visit Cloughton from there.
- Head into N. Wales for several days. Lots of family places to visit and
family members to meet.
- Take ferry to Ireland. Stay in Dublin.
- Visit Clough Castle in N. Ireland.
- Go home from Dublin.
We are now down to 15 trip members. It would be best to have 20 in the group
so if anyone else is interested in going please contact me ASAP.
We will be changing the dates of the trip as well. We will be going either
later in April or in the beginning of May.
